.u-section-1 {background-image: url("images/iitr.jpg"); background-position: 50% 50%}
.u-section-1 .u-sheet-1 {min-height: 427px} 

@media (max-width: 1199px){ .u-section-1 .u-sheet-1 {min-height: 620px} }

@media (max-width: 991px){ .u-section-1 {background-position: 92.28% 56.31%; background-size: 115%}
.u-section-1 .u-sheet-1 {min-height: 518px} }

@media (max-width: 767px){ .u-section-1 .u-sheet-1 {min-height: 420px} }

@media (max-width: 575px){ .u-section-1 .u-sheet-1 {min-height: 264px} }.u-section-2 .u-sheet-1 {min-height: 632px}
.u-section-2 .u-text-1 {font-size: 3rem; font-weight: 700; width: 816px; margin: 34px auto 0}
.u-section-2 .u-list-1 {min-height: 289px; grid-template-columns: calc(33.3333% - 20px) calc(33.3333% - 20px) calc(33.3333% - 20px); grid-gap: 30px 30px; margin: 34px auto 0}
.u-section-2 .u-list-item-1 {background-image: none}
.u-section-2 .u-container-layout-1 {padding: 30px}
.u-section-2 .u-icon-1 {height: 95px; width: 95px; background-image: none; margin: 0 auto}
.u-section-2 .u-text-2 {font-size: 1.5rem; font-weight: 400; margin: 20px 0 0}
.u-section-2 .u-btn-1 {padding: 0}
.u-section-2 .u-list-item-2 {background-size: auto}
.u-section-2 .u-container-layout-2 {padding: 30px}
.u-section-2 .u-icon-2 {height: 95px; width: 95px; background-image: none; margin: 0 auto}
.u-section-2 .u-text-3 {font-size: 1.5rem; font-weight: 400; margin: 20px 0 0}
.u-section-2 .u-btn-2 {padding: 0}
.u-section-2 .u-list-item-3 {background-size: auto}
.u-section-2 .u-container-layout-3 {padding: 30px}
.u-section-2 .u-icon-3 {height: 95px; width: 95px; background-image: none; margin: 0 auto}
.u-section-2 .u-text-4 {font-size: 1.5rem; font-weight: 400; margin: 20px 0 0}
.u-section-2 .u-btn-3 {padding: 0}
.u-section-2 .u-list-item-3 {background-size: auto}
.u-section-2 .u-container-layout-3 {padding: 30px}
.u-section-2 .u-icon-3 {height: 95px; width: 95px; background-image: none; margin: 0 auto}
.u-section-2 .u-text-4 {font-size: 1.5rem; font-weight: 400; margin: 20px 0 0}
.u-section-2 .u-btn-4 {padding: 0}
.u-section-2 .u-list-item-3 {background-size: auto}
.u-section-2 .u-container-layout-3 {padding: 30px}
.u-section-2 .u-icon-3 {height: 95px; width: 95px; background-image: none; margin: 0 auto}
.u-section-2 .u-text-4 {font-size: 1.5rem; font-weight: 400; margin: 20px 0 0}
.u-section-2 .u-btn-5 {padding: 0}
.u-section-2 .u-list-item-6 {background-size: auto; width: 360px; margin-right: auto; margin-left: auto}
.u-section-2 .u-container-layout-6 {padding: 30px}
.u-section-2 .u-icon-6 {height: 95px; width: 95px; background-image: none; margin: 0 auto}
.u-section-2 .u-text-7 {font-size: 1.5rem; font-weight: 400; margin: 20px 0 0}
.u-section-2 .u-btn-6 {padding: 0} 

@media (max-width: 1199px){ .u-section-2 .u-sheet-1 {min-height: 712px}
.u-section-2 .u-text-1 {width: 734px}
.u-section-2 .u-list-1 {min-height: 238px; margin-right: initial; margin-left: initial}
.u-section-2 .u-container-layout-1 {padding-left: 20px; padding-right: 20px}
.u-section-2 .u-container-layout-2 {padding-left: 20px; padding-right: 20px}
.u-section-2 .u-container-layout-3 {padding-left: 20px; padding-right: 20px}
.u-section-2 .u-container-layout-3 {padding-left: 20px; padding-right: 20px}
.u-section-2 .u-container-layout-3 {padding-left: 20px; padding-right: 20px}
.u-section-2 .u-container-layout-6 {padding-left: 20px; padding-right: 20px} }

@media (max-width: 991px){ .u-section-2 .u-sheet-1 {min-height: 884px}
.u-section-2 .u-text-1 {width: 720px}
.u-section-2 .u-list-1 {min-height: 410px; grid-template-columns: repeat(2, calc(((100% - 720px) / 2)  + 345px)); margin-right: initial; margin-left: initial} }

@media (max-width: 767px){ .u-section-2 .u-text-1 {width: 540px}
.u-section-2 .u-list-1 {grid-template-columns: 100%; margin-top: 14px; margin-right: initial; margin-left: initial}
.u-section-2 .u-container-layout-1 {padding-left: 30px; padding-right: 30px}
.u-section-2 .u-container-layout-2 {padding-left: 30px; padding-right: 30px}
.u-section-2 .u-container-layout-3 {padding-left: 30px; padding-right: 30px}
.u-section-2 .u-container-layout-3 {padding-left: 30px; padding-right: 30px}
.u-section-2 .u-container-layout-3 {padding-left: 30px; padding-right: 30px}
.u-section-2 .u-container-layout-6 {padding-left: 30px; padding-right: 30px} }

@media (max-width: 575px){ .u-section-2 .u-text-1 {width: 340px}
.u-section-2 .u-list-1 {margin-top: -119px; margin-right: initial; margin-left: initial} }